ChatLaw终极指南:如何用中文法律大模型构建你的专属AI律师
ChatLaw终极指南:如何用中文法律大模型构建你的专属AI律师
【免费下载链接】ChatLawChatLaw:A Powerful LLM Tailored for Chinese Legal. 中文法律大模型项目地址: https://gitcode.com/gh_mirrors/ch/ChatLaw
想象一下,当你遇到法律问题时,身边有一位24小时待命的专业律师助理,能准确引用法律条文、分析案例、提供专业建议——这就是ChatLaw带给你的价值。作为一款专为中文法律场景设计的开源大语言模型,ChatLaw采用知识图谱与专家混合架构,让普通人也能轻松获取专业法律咨询服务。无论你是法律从业者、企业法务,还是普通公民,这款法律AI助手都能成为你解决法律问题的得力工具。
🚀 为什么选择ChatLaw?三大核心优势解析
1. 精准的法律条文匹配能力
ChatLaw最大的亮点在于它能像专业律师一样准确引用法律条文。通过知识图谱技术,系统能快速从海量法律文档中检索出最相关的法条,确保回答的法律依据准确可靠。
2. 多智能体协作系统
不同于传统单一模型,ChatLaw采用多智能体架构,模拟真实律师事务所的工作流程。想象一下,当你提出一个离婚案件咨询时,系统会同时调动:
- 法律助理:收集案件基本信息
- 法律研究员:检索相关法律条文和判例
- 资深律师:综合分析并给出专业建议
ChatLaw多智能体协作处理法律咨询的完整流程,从信息收集到报告生成
3. 超越GPT-4的专业表现
在专业法律能力测试中,ChatLaw在Lawbench和全国统一法律职业资格考试中分别比GPT-4高出7.73%准确率和11分。这意味着在中文法律场景下,ChatLaw的专业性更强,回答更准确。
📦 三步快速上手:15分钟部署你的法律AI
第一步:环境准备与代码获取
确保你的系统有Python 3.8+和至少16GB内存,然后克隆项目:
git clone https://gitcode.com/gh_mirrors/ch/ChatLaw cd ChatLaw第二步:安装依赖与启动服务
使用pip安装所需依赖:
pip install -r requirements.txt💡小贴士:建议使用虚拟环境避免依赖冲突。安装完成后可运行python -c "import torch; print(torch.cuda.is_available())"验证GPU支持。
第三步:启动Web界面
进入demo目录启动服务:
cd demo python web.py打开浏览器访问http://localhost:7860,你将看到ChatLaw的友好界面:
ChatLaw简洁直观的Web界面,提供对话、写作、知识库三大核心功能
🔧 四大核心功能深度体验
场景一:日常法律问题咨询
👉适用场景:合同审查、劳动纠纷、消费维权等日常法律问题
假设你遇到租房纠纷,只需在对话框中描述具体情况,ChatLaw会自动:
- 提取关键词(如"租房合同"、"押金退还")
- 检索相关法律条文(《合同法》《民法典》相关条款)
- 提供具体建议和操作步骤
✅使用技巧:问题描述越详细,回答越精准。尽量包含时间、地点、金额等关键信息。
场景二:专业法律研究辅助
👉适用场景:法律从业者研究、学术论文写作、案例分析
ChatLaw的向量数据库存储了大量法律条文和案例,支持:
- 多轮对话深入探讨法律问题
- 相似案例匹配和对比分析
- 法律条文的历史版本对比
ChatLaw分析网络名誉侵权案例,展示法律条文引用和责任认定过程
场景三:合同起草与审查
👉适用场景:企业法务、创业者、自由职业者
在"写作"标签页中,ChatLaw提供专业的合同模板和审查功能:
- 选择合同类型(租赁、雇佣、买卖等)
- 输入合同基本条款
- 系统自动识别风险点并提供修改建议
场景四:法律知识库管理
👉适用场景:律所知识管理、企业合规建设
你可以导入自定义法律文档到data/knowledge目录,扩展ChatLaw的知识范围。系统支持:
- PDF/TXT格式文档自动解析
- 关键词索引和快速检索
- 知识图谱可视化展示
🛠️ 高级定制:让ChatLaw更懂你的需求
模型参数调优指南
根据你的硬件条件和需求,可以调整以下参数:
| 参数 | 推荐值 | 作用说明 |
|---|---|---|
| temperature | 0.1-0.3 | 控制回答的随机性,值越低回答越确定 |
| top_p | 0.8-0.95 | 控制回答的多样性,平衡创新与准确 |
| max_new_tokens | 128-512 | 控制回答长度,根据问题复杂度调整 |
自定义知识库导入
将你的法律文档整理为txt或pdf格式,放置在data/knowledge目录下,然后运行导入脚本。系统会自动:
- 解析文档内容
- 构建向量索引
- 集成到知识图谱中
⚠️注意:导入大量文档时建议分批处理,避免内存溢出。
性能优化配置
如果你的硬件资源有限,可以:
- 使用较小的模型版本(如ChatLaw-13B)
- 开启量化压缩减少内存占用
- 调整batch_size参数平衡速度与精度
🎯 性能对比:ChatLaw为何脱颖而出
ChatLaw在多项法律任务中表现出色,特别是在中文法律场景下。从下面的性能对比图可以看出,ChatLaw在与其他主流法律AI模型的对比中保持了显著优势:
ChatLaw与其他法律AI模型的胜率对比,颜色越深表示胜率越高
核心优势对比:
- 准确率更高:在Lawbench测试中超越GPT-4
- 响应速度更快:优化的架构设计减少延迟
- 中文适配更好:专门针对中文法律语料训练
- 成本更低:开源免费,无需付费API调用
🔍 技术架构揭秘:ChatLaw如何工作
ChatLaw的技术架构融合了现代AI技术的最佳实践:
ChatLaw混合架构示意图,展示关键词提取、向量检索和LLM协同工作流程
三层架构设计:
- 前端交互层:基于Gradio的Web界面,支持自然语言对话
- 中间处理层:多智能体协作系统,模拟律师事务所工作流
- 后端支撑层:知识图谱+向量数据库+专家混合模型
🚨 常见问题与解决方案
问题1:模型加载缓慢或失败
可能原因:内存不足、模型文件损坏、依赖版本冲突解决方案:
- 关闭其他内存占用大的程序
- 检查模型文件完整性,重新下载缺失部分
- 使用
pip install -r requirements.txt --upgrade更新依赖
问题2:回答质量不高或偏离主题
可能原因:问题描述不清、参数设置不当解决方案:
- 提供更具体的问题描述,包含关键细节
- 降低temperature值(如设为0.2)
- 切换到"专业"模式获取更严谨分析
问题3:Web界面无法访问
可能原因:端口占用、防火墙限制解决方案:
- 检查端口占用:
netstat -tuln | grep 7860 - 更换端口启动:
python web.py --port 7861 - 检查防火墙设置,允许对应端口
📈 最佳实践与进阶路线
新手入门(第1周)
- 完成基础部署和界面熟悉
- 尝试简单的法律问题咨询
- 了解基本参数设置
熟练使用(第2-4周)
- 掌握多轮对话技巧
- 学习合同审查功能
- 导入自定义知识库
专业应用(1-3个月)
- 深入理解技术架构
- 定制化模型参数
- 集成到工作流程中
专家级(3个月以上)
- 研究源码,了解实现细节
- 参与社区贡献
- 探索企业级部署方案
⚖️ 使用建议与伦理考量
虽然ChatLaw在法律咨询方面表现出色,但请记住:
- 辅助工具定位:ChatLaw的回答仅供参考,不能替代专业律师意见
- 重大案件咨询:涉及重大利益的法律问题应咨询执业律师
- 隐私保护:避免在对话中输入敏感个人信息
- 结果验证:重要法律结论应通过官方渠道验证
🎉 开始你的法律AI之旅
现在你已经掌握了ChatLaw的完整使用指南。无论是日常法律咨询、专业研究,还是企业合规建设,这款开源法律AI助手都能为你提供强大支持。记住,法律知识的学习和应用是一个持续的过程,而ChatLaw将成为你在这个过程中的得力伙伴。
👉下一步行动:
- 立即克隆项目开始体验
- 加入社区讨论,分享使用心得
- 关注项目更新,获取最新功能
让ChatLaw成为你的专属AI律师,开启智能法律咨询的新时代!
【免费下载链接】ChatLawChatLaw:A Powerful LLM Tailored for Chinese Legal. 中文法律大模型项目地址: https://gitcode.com/gh_mirrors/ch/ChatLaw
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
